  1. How much of your roadmap is focused on big bets vs incremental improvements?

    It depends on the roadmap that we are building. There needs a balance of both. The Big bets are more the innovations that will help do a leap frog. Given significant investment here, this is usually vetted with multiple stakeholders. The incremental innovations are another way to accelerate the speed of delivery and help course correct quickly. This is something that I use more for quicker delivery and validation. Sometimes these also are build with partnerships across multiple design partners

  2. What methods or frameworks do you use to generate and evaluate new product ideas?

    For me, the criteria for evaluating good ideas should include uniqueness, feasibility, positive impact, and alignment with organizational goals.
    Every idea needs to be vetted thoroughly. Here is my thought flow chart

    • Conduct market research.

    • Consider the competition.

    • Determine whether your product idea solves a problem.

    • Does it have a large impact.

    • Is it profitable

      Then comes the relevance and feasibility of execution and deliverability.

  4. What do product managers get wrong when trying to innovate on their existing products?

    1. Lack of Customer Focus: Confusing customer wants with needs: Product managers may focus on features customers request rather than understanding the underlying needs they are trying to fulfill.  Ignoring customer feedback: Not actively soliciting and incorporating customer feedback can lead to products that don't meet real-world needs.  Not understanding the customer: A lack of deep understanding of the target audience, their pain points, and behaviors can lead to products that miss the mark.  ...Read More
